Cosmoshub
We have seen Cosmoshub v7-Theta update this week, the most exciting feature is sure "interchain accounts", enabled interchain accounts enabled L1's can use this feature to
- Create and control accounts on the Cosmos Hub
- Perform Cosmos Hub native transactions
with this and next updates Cosmoshub, like shared security, will be the center of the multichain ecosystem.

Crescent Network
Finally arrived Crescent Network which provides multi-chain asset exchange and capital-efficient liquidity incentivization, it was the smoothest and clever launch we have ever seen on Cosmos, very cool airdrop claiming process that guides you to use all the features. The network saw a small attack since it was gasless (fear of many gasless DEX at this point).
Gno.land
Announced by the co-founder of Cosmos Jae Kwon his new project's airdrop, gno.land, which is new Layer 1 project project built on Cosmos enabling smartcontracts and more. A quick reminder, snapshot will be on July 4th for $ATOM holders, stakers and probably ATOM-OSMO LP'ers. Mark your calenders.
